1. One-Room Treehouse In Spicewood

source: Glamping Hub

This dreamy one-bedroom treehouse features a queen-size bed and accommodates two people. Guests also have access to communal washrooms, a barbecue area, a pool, small lake, and more!

2. Magical Treehouse In Utopia

Utopia, Texas is home to four beautiful treehouses on the banks of the Sabinal River. Each treehouse has its own theme, and is outfitted with a bedroom, sitting room, full bathroom, and outdoor decks. They are also equipped with both heating and air conditioning for enjoyment any time of the year!

3. Modern Treehouse In Spicewood

source: Glamping Hub

Check out this modern industrial treehouse located in Spicewood, Texas. This treehouse accommodates two to three guests, and features a king-size bed plus a small loft which can also be used as sleeping space. Each treehouse has its own private bathhouse, complete with a soaking tub and separate shower.

4. Romantic, Luxury Treehouse In Spicewood

source: Glamping Hub

This luxury treehouse in Spicewood is perfect for a romantic weekend getaway. Each treehouse features a wraparound porch, perfect for enjoying 360-degree views of the surrounding treetops.

5. Resort-Inspired Treehouse In New Braunfels

source: Glamping Hub

If you’re more of a five-star resort person than a glamper, this luxury treehouse near the Guadalupe River in New Braunfels will probably appeal to you. This mega treehouse sleeps eight people, complete with a resort-style pool and swim-up bar!

6. Charming Treehouse On A Private Ranch

source: Glamping Hub

Let’s scale it back a bit with this simple yet charming treehouse situated on a private ranch in Central Texas. Guests also have access to an outdoor swimming pool and 40 private acres to explore.

7. Rustic Treehouse In Columbus

source: Glamping Hub

This treehouse located in Columbus, Texas may be rustic, but it’s pretty well-appointed! This cozy treehouse sleeps two guests, and the ground level features a wood-fired hot tub and brick pizza oven!

8. Waterfront Treehouse In Seguin

source: Glamping Hub

This spacious treehouse in Seguin, Texas sleeps six or more, and is located right on the banks of the Geronimo Creek. Guests also have access to paddle boards, kayaks, and even a rope swing for those who are adventurous enough to enter the water that way!
